Question 81404: If F(x) = 3x^2 - 5x and G(x) = 2x - 4, find G of F(2) and F of G(2)

In order to find g(f(2)), just find f(2) and then g() it. For example...




Please note that f(2) equaling 2 is just a coincidence.
So the question asks for g(f(2)). Since f(2) equals 2, then g(f(2)) is the same thing as g(2). Now apply the g formula.




So g(f(2)) = 0.
Now just because g(f(2)) equals 0 doesnt mean f(g(2)) equals 0. You need to redo it for the second problem, just in a different way. Find g(2) and then f() it.




Since g(2) = 0, then f(g(2)) is the same thing as f(0). So find the function of 0 with the f(x) formula.





So f(g(2)) = 0
